IntelliJ IDÉ | |
---|---|
| |
Sorts | integrerad utvecklingsmiljö |
Utvecklaren | jetbrains [1] |
Skrivet i | Java |
Gränssnitt | Gunga |
Operativ system | Microsoft Windows [3] , Linux [4] och macOS [5] |
Hårdvaruplattform | Java Virtual Machine |
senaste versionen | 2022.2 [2] (26 juli 2022 ) |
Licens |
|
Hemsida | jetbrains.com/ru-ru/idea/ |
Mediafiler på Wikimedia Commons |
IntelliJ IDEA är en integrerad mjukvaruutvecklingsmiljö för många programmeringsspråk , särskilt Java , JavaScript , Python , utvecklad av JetBrains .
Den första versionen dök upp i januari 2001 och blev snabbt populär som den första miljön för Java med ett brett utbud av integrerade refactoring- verktyg [6] som gjorde det möjligt för programmerare att snabbt refactorera programkällkoden. Utformningen av miljön är fokuserad på programmerares produktivitet, vilket gör att de kan koncentrera sig på funktionella uppgifter, medan IntelliJ IDEA tar hand om rutinoperationer.
Från och med den sjätte versionen av produkten tillhandahåller IntelliJ IDEA en integrerad verktygslåda för att utveckla ett grafiskt användargränssnitt . Bland andra funktioner är miljön mycket kompatibel med många populära gratis utvecklarverktyg som CVS , Subversion , Apache Ant , Maven och JUnit . I februari 2007 tillkännagav IntelliJ-utvecklarna en tidig version av en plugin för att stödja Ruby -programmering [7] .
Från och med version 9.0 finns miljön tillgänglig i två utgåvor: Community Edition och Ultimate Edition . Community Edition är en helt gratis version, tillgänglig under Apache 2.0 -licensen , med fullt stöd för Java SE , Kotlin , Groovy , Scala och integration med de mest populära versionskontrollsystemen . Ultimate Edition, tillgänglig under en kommersiell licens, ger stöd för Java EE , UML -diagram , kodtäckningsberäkning och stöd för andra versionskontrollsystem, språk och ramverk [8] .
Språk som stöds:
Ett antal språk stöds genom tredjeparts plugins, såsom OCaml , GLSL , Erlang , Fantom , Haskell , Lua , Mathematica , Perl5 , Object Pascal .
jetbrains | |
---|---|
Integrerad utvecklingsmiljö | |
.NET och Visual Studio | |
Lagarbete | |
Programmeringsspråk |
ID | |
---|---|
Universell | |
C / C++ | |
GRUNDLÄGGANDE | |
Java |
|
Pascal | |
PHP |
|
Pytonorm |
|
ActionScript | |
rubin | |
jämförelse |